Abortion rights have majority support across the country, even in red states. A recent study by the Public Religion Research Institute found that a majority of citizens in 43 states say abortion should be legal in most or all cases. In 13 states, abortion rights are favored by over 70% of voters. They have voted against proposed state-level anti-abortion bans in Kansas, Kentucky, and Montana, and passed constitutional amendments to preserve abortion rights in California, Vermont, and Michigan. Now, voter initiatives protecting reproductive rights have already been placed on the ballot for 2024 in New York and Maryland, and efforts are underway in Florida and Ohio. Between potential voter initiatives and Democratic majority state legislatures, a recent analysis by Daily Kos identified 23 states, plus the District of Columbia, where there is sufficient voter support to enshrine abortion rights in state constitutions. Collectively, these states represent 58% of the U.S. population. Flesch reading score measures how complex a text is. The lower the score, the more difficult the text is to read. The Flesch readability score uses the average length of your sentences (measured by the number of words) and the average number of syllables per word in an equation to calculate the reading ease. Text with a very high Flesch reading ease score (about 100) is straightforward and easy to read, with short sentences and no words of more than two syllables. Usually, a reading ease score of 60-70 is considered acceptable/normal for web copy.
